Direct laryngoscopy was used in 178 (98.9%) cases and uncuffed tube was used in 135 (75.0%) cases. Apneic oxygenation was performed in 26 (14.4%) cases—all in pediatric ED. Intubation was predominantly performed by senior clinicians (162, 90.0%).
